8 Skincare Mistakes and How to Fix Them

When it comes to taking care of your skin, there are so many misconceptions out there that you probably have no idea about. Some of them could end up damaging your skin and doing more harm than good.

Skin care is an essential part of personal wellness, but it’s easy to fall into habits that can do more harm than good. Common mistakes include over-exfoliating, which can strip the skin of its natural oils and lead to irritation or dryness. The key is to exfoliate only once or twice a week, using a gentle scrub or chemical exfoliator suitable for your skin type. Another common mistake is using products that are not suitable for your skin type. For example, heavy creams can clog pores on oily skin, while light moisturizers may not be moisturizing enough for dry skin.

1. Not applying sunscreen

This is probably the worst grooming mistake you can ever make. Not only can negligence lead to the formation of wrinkles at a young age, it can also increase your chances of skin cancer.

Sunscreen is an integral part of your skin care routine, regardless of age, gender, skin tone, etc. Many people also make the mistake of applying sunscreen only in summers. The fact is, you should use sunscreen every day before going outside. Even if the sun isn’t shining directly, its harmful rays can reflect off other surfaces, such as snow, water, etc., and cause damage to your skin.

How to fix it:

The solution to this is of course to put on sunscreen every time you leave your house. Pick one that suits your skin type and try choosing a mineral over a chemical. This is because there are many health risks associated with chemicals.

2. Use of hot water

Care routine for smooth skin - ML Delicate Beauty

There is nothing better than taking a hot shower after a long day. However, do you have any idea how damaging this can be to your skin? Hot water can strip your skin of all its natural oils, leaving it dry and dehydrated. By showering or washing your face with warm water, you prevent the cells from locking in the moisture they need. In addition, it can also aggravate some existing skin conditions.

How to fix it:

Be sure to wash your face with lukewarm or cool water. It will keep the skin’s moisture intact while doing an effective job of cleansing.

3. Do not wash the pillowcase often

This is often overlooked. We think that just because we’ve washed our face before bed or showered, we’re good to go. But the truth is, if you keep using the same pillowcase for weeks, you’re likely to get acne. Your pillowcase can accumulate dead cells, dirt and oil, so it’s important to wash it often.

How to fix it:

In addition to washing your pillowcase every 4-5 days, invest in a soft silk or satin pillowcase as it causes less friction between your skin/hair and the pillowcase. This is particularly beneficial for those with sensitive skin or conditions such as acne, as the soft material minimizes irritation. For hair, the smoother surface of silk or satin helps reduce breakage and frizz, as they don’t catch or pull hair like traditional cotton tweezers. This is especially beneficial for those with curly or textured hair. Plus, these materials are less absorbent than cotton, meaning they won’t pull moisture away from your skin and hair, helping to maintain natural moisture levels.

4. Does not moisturize after cleansing

This is an important step that you should never miss. If you want to know why, it’s because cleansing can make your skin slightly dry. It can even leave your skin feeling itchy. This is especially true if you use hot water.

How to fix it:

Make it a general rule for yourself to moisturize your skin every time you shower or clean your face. Equally important is the time of hydration. Ideally, you should do this immediately after showering. If you don’t do this, your skin may be more prone to dryness and dehydration. 5. Consuming too much sugar

Care rituals for glowing and beautiful skin - ML Delicate Beauty

It’s true what they say: “You are what you eat”. If you’re wondering what sugar has to do with skincare, trust us when we say the link is stronger than you think. Eating too much sugar on a daily basis can lead to poor skin and health. This is because sugar intake causes your glucose levels to rise, which, in turn, increases insulin. This causes your skin to produce more oil, therefore, making your acne worse.

How to fix it:

We would suggest that you replace the sugar with more natural sweeteners, such as fruit. That way, you won’t feel deprived and your skin won’t suffer. Even if you crave foods high in sugar, have them every once in a while as opposed to not having them at all. You will notice the difference it will make in your skin.

6. Blindly following skin care routines

With social media the way it is today, you’ll see many bloggers and influencers posting their skincare routines on platforms like Instagram. While they may seem legit, what you need to remember is that different routines affect different skin types in different ways. What may work for some will not necessarily work for others. Therefore, you need to have a skincare routine that suits your skin type. So while it may be tempting to follow the trend, don’t bother with it. You might just end up doing your skin more harm than good.

How to fix it:

Research different skin care routines and find out what works for your specific skin type and concerns. 7. You don’t get enough sleep

Lack of sleep is directly linked to the appearance of your skin. If you don’t get enough sleep, your skin will start to look dull and full of eye bags and dark circles. No amount of makeup in the world can fix these problems. It will lose its natural glow and show on your face.

How to fix it:

The solution to this is obvious, get several hours of sleep! We’re all guilty of it, but it’s so important for your health and skin. An average of eight hours of sleep is recommended. Apart from this, your sleeping hours also matter. If you’re sleeping at 3am every day, then that’s not going to help your skin, so try to go to bed at a decent hour.

8. Use of hard ingredients

Woman taking care of her skin - ML Delicate Beauty

Some scrubs and skin care products contain ingredients that can be harsh on the skin. This is especially for those with sensitive skin. Although you may not realize it, many cleansers often make skincare mistakes because they contain harmful ingredients that can strip the skin of its natural oils and moisture.

How to fix it:

Always look for products that are gentler on the skin. Cream cleansers may be a good choice for you as opposed to gel and foam products, which could be harsher on your skin. The key is to use skincare products in moderation and choose them carefully after researching the ingredients in them.
